2024 wage data from the Bureau of Labor Statistics
Advertising Sales Agents is a moderate occupation in Washington, DC-VA-MD-WV, with a median annual salary of $61,590. Advertising Sales Agentss in Washington, DC-VA-MD-WV earn $130 more (0%) than the national median of $61,460. There is significant earning potential โ top earners make 3.
Advertising Sales Agentss in Washington, DC-VA-MD-WV earn $130 more (0%) than the national median of $61,460.
The average salary ($76,410) is notably higher than the median โ this means top earners pull the average up. A small number of highly paid Advertising Sales Agentss skew the data.
About 1,380 Advertising Sales Agentss work in Washington, DC-VA-MD-WV, indicating a healthy local job market.

| Percentile | Annual Salary | Monthly |
|---|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$39,000 | $3,250 |
| 25th Percentile | $47,830 | $3,986 |
| Median | $61,590 | $5,133 |
| 75th Percentile | $80,270 | $6,689 |
| 90th Percentile | $130,280 | $10,857 |
| Mean (Average) | $76,410 | $6,368 |
